Exploring AWS On Demand Pricing – Flexible Cloud Costs

Amazon Web Services (AWS) offers a range of pricing models to cater to the diverse needs of its users. Among these, AWS On Demand Pricing stands out for its flexibility and ease of use. This article delves into the intricacies of AWS On Demand Pricing, helping businesses and individuals understand how to leverage this model for optimal cloud resource utilization and cost efficiency.

What is AWS On Demand Pricing?

AWS On Demand Pricing is a payment model where users pay for compute capacity by the hour or second, with no long-term commitments or upfront payments. This model offers the flexibility to scale computing resources up or down based on demand, making it an ideal choice for applications with irregular or unpredictable workloads.

Understanding the Flexibility of AWS On Demand Pricing

The primary advantage of AWS On Demand Pricing is its flexibility. Users can start or stop instances at any time, paying only for the compute time they consume. This model is particularly beneficial for short-term, irregular workloads that cannot be interrupted, such as developing new applications or running high-performance computing applications.

Comparing AWS On Demand Pricing with Other Models

AWS offers several pricing options, each tailored to specific usage patterns. It’s crucial to understand how On Demand Pricing compares with other models like Reserved Instances, Spot Instances, and Savings Plans.

  1. Reserved Instances: Suitable for applications with steady state usage, offering up to 75% savings compared to On Demand rates.
  2. Spot Instances: Ideal for flexible workloads, allowing users to bid for unused capacity at lower prices.
  3. Savings Plans: Provide significant savings over On Demand rates in exchange for a commitment to a consistent amount of usage (in $/hour) for a 1 or 3-year period.

AWS On Demand Pricing for Different Services

AWS On Demand Pricing is not limited to EC2 instances. It extends to various AWS services, including Amazon DynamoDB, where users can benefit from the ability to handle unpredictable workloads without provisioning capacity in advance.

Cost Management with AWS On Demand Pricing

Effective cost management is crucial when using AWS On Demand Pricing. Tools like AWS Cost Explorer, as detailed in our AWS Cost Explorer Guide, are instrumental in monitoring and optimizing AWS costs. These tools provide insights into usage patterns, helping users make informed decisions about scaling and cost optimization.

Best Practices for Using AWS On Demand Pricing

Monitor Usage Regularly

  1. Set Up Alerts and Notifications: Utilize AWS CloudWatch to set up alerts for when your usage approaches your budget limit. This proactive approach helps in avoiding overages.
  2. Use AWS Cost Explorer: Regularly review your AWS Cost Explorer data to understand your spending patterns. This tool provides detailed insights into your AWS usage, helping you identify areas where you might be over or under-utilizing resources.
  3. Conduct Frequent Audits: Periodically audit your AWS environment. Look for unused or underused instances and services, and shut them down or scale them appropriately to avoid unnecessary costs.

Optimize Resource Utilization

  1. Implement Auto-Scaling: Use AWS Auto Scaling to adjust capacity automatically, ensuring you maintain performance while keeping costs low. This is particularly useful for applications with variable workloads.
  2. Rightsize Instances: Regularly evaluate your instance types and sizes. Downsizing or changing to a more appropriate instance type can lead to significant cost savings.
  3. Leverage Elastic Load Balancing: Distribute incoming application traffic across multiple targets, such as Amazon EC2 instances, to optimize performance and cost.
  4. Utilize Amazon CloudFront: Implement Amazon CloudFront for content delivery. It can reduce the load on your servers and potentially decrease the number of instances required.

Evaluate Needs Continuously

  1. Review Application Performance: Regularly assess the performance of your applications. Understanding the resource usage and demand patterns can help you make informed decisions about scaling up or down.
  2. Stay Informed on New AWS Features and Services: AWS continuously evolves, offering new services and features that can be more efficient and cost-effective. Stay updated and consider adopting these innovations where they fit.
  3. Plan for Long-Term Needs: While On Demand Pricing is excellent for flexibility, it might not be the most cost-effective for long-term, steady workloads. In such cases, consider switching to Reserved Instances or Savings Plans.
  4. Conduct Cost-Benefit Analysis for Different Pricing Models: Periodically perform a cost-benefit analysis to determine if continuing with On Demand Pricing is the most economical choice for your current and projected usage.

By following these best practices, you can effectively manage your AWS On Demand Pricing model, ensuring that you are maximizing the value of your AWS investment while keeping costs under control.

AWS On Demand Pricing: A Boon for Startups

Startups, known for their dynamic nature and evolving requirements, find a perfect ally in AWS On Demand Pricing. This pricing model aligns seamlessly with the typical startup ethos – agility, scalability, and cost-effectiveness.

Tailored for Startup Growth

  1. Pay-As-You-Go Flexibility: AWS On Demand Pricing allows startups to pay only for the resources they consume. This model eliminates the need for large upfront investments in hardware and infrastructure, which is a significant advantage for startups working with limited budgets and resources.
  2. Scalability to Match Growth: As startups grow, their technology needs can change rapidly. AWS On Demand Pricing provides the scalability necessary to accommodate these changing needs, allowing startups to scale up or down without financial penalties.
  3. Cost-Efficiency in Early Stages: For startups in their early stages, every penny counts. AWS On Demand Pricing helps in maintaining low initial costs while providing the flexibility to experiment with different AWS services.

Leveraging Cloudvisor’s Expertise

Startups might lack the in-house expertise to manage complex cloud infrastructures. This is where AWS partners like Cloudvisor come into play. Cloudvisor offers free consultations and guidance, helping startups navigate their cloud journey effectively. Their expertise in securing AWS credits through the AWS Activate program can be particularly beneficial for startups looking to maximize their cloud potential while minimizing costs.

Additional Benefits with Cloudvisor

By partnering with Cloudvisor, startups not only gain access to AWS’s flexible pricing but also enjoy additional benefits:

  1. Instant Discounts and Free AWS Credits: Cloudvisor helps startups secure AWS credits, which can significantly reduce the cost of cloud services in the crucial early stages of business development.
  2. Technical Support and Guidance: With Cloudvisor, startups receive expert advice on AWS-related topics, ensuring they choose the right services and best practice architectures for their specific needs.
  3. Cost Optimization Services: Cloudvisor conducts yearly free Cost Optimization and Well-Architected Reviews, helping startups optimize their AWS infrastructure for both performance and cost.

For startups, AWS On Demand Pricing is more than just a pricing model; it’s a strategic tool that aligns with their growth trajectory and evolving needs. Coupled with the support and expertise of AWS partners like Cloudvisor, startups can harness the full power of AWS to fuel their growth, ensuring they have the technological foundation to scale rapidly and efficiently.

Conclusion

AWS On Demand Pricing offers a flexible and user-friendly approach to cloud computing, making it an excellent choice for a variety of applications. By understanding and effectively managing this pricing model, users can enjoy the full benefits of AWS’s powerful cloud capabilities without committing to long-term contracts or upfront payments.

Ready to save on your AWS bill?
Book a free consultation with us to find out more about how you can save on your AWS bill!

Other Articles

Get the latest articles and news about AWS